Artificial intelligence has changed the economics of SA incorporation: automatic invoice reading reaches recognition rates that make manual entry marginal, and posting suggestions learn from corrections. The accountant does not disappear — the job shifts from data entry to control and advice.

Electronic archiving is fully recognised: Swiss bookkeeping regulation admits electronic retention of records provided integrity and readability are guaranteed for the 10 years of art. 958f CO. A paper binder is no longer an obligation — provided the archiving system is serious.

What are the legal obligations for SA incorporation in Switzerland?

The foundation is the Code of Obligations: proper bookkeeping (art. 957a CO), annual accounts (balance sheet, income statement, notes) and 10-year retention of books and records (art. 958f CO). VAT applies from CHF 100,000 of turnover, and social insurance settlements from the first employee. Nothing is different in Fulenbach: federal law applies.

What is simplified bookkeeping and who can use it?

Sole proprietorships and partnerships under CHF 500,000 of revenue may limit themselves to recording income, expenses and assets (art. 957 para. 2 CO). Once over the threshold — or upon founding a Sàrl or an SA — full accounts with balance sheet, income statement and notes become mandatory. What are the current Swiss VAT rates?

Since 1 January 2024: 8.1% (standard), 2.6% (reduced — for example food and medicines) and 3.8% (accommodation). Returns must be filed and paid within 60 days after the period ends (quarterly under the effective method, semi-annually under the net tax rate method).
